Skip to main content

Rotate Image by EXIF - Auto Orientation API

PDF4me Rotate Image By EXIF Data is a powerful enterprise-grade solution that automatically rotates images based on EXIF orientation data through advanced API integration. This comprehensive image rotation service efficiently processes image files, providing automatic orientation correction, intelligent EXIF data analysis, smart rotation algorithms, and advanced image processing capabilities for enhanced photo processing and content management. The API processes image rotation by receiving source images through REST API calls, utilizing advanced EXIF data analysis and intelligent orientation algorithms for accurate image correction and professional image processing. With comprehensive support for EXIF data analysis, automatic orientation correction, intelligent rotation algorithms, and professional image processing, this solution is ideal for photo processing, content management, automated orientation correction, and enterprise image workflows that require reliable image rotation with guaranteed accuracy and consistent output quality. Rotate Image By EXIF Data documents easily with API for advanced image processing and orientation correction.

Authenticating Your API Request

To access the PDF4me REST API, every request must include proper authentication credentials. Authentication ensures secure communication and validates your identity as an authorized user of the REST API.

Key Features

  • Automatic EXIF Analysis: Automatically detect and apply correct image orientation based on EXIF data
  • Intelligent Rotation: Smart rotation algorithms that preserve image quality and content
  • Format Support: Support for various image formats including JPG, PNG, BMP, TIFF, and more
  • Quality Preservation: Maintain image quality during automatic rotation operations
  • Professional Results: High-quality image rotation with accurate orientation correction
  • Seamless API Integration: RESTful API designed for automated image processing workflows and enterprise system integration

REST API Endpoint

The PDF4me REST API uses standard HTTP methods to interact with resources. All EXIF-based image rotation operations are performed through a single endpoint:

  • Method: POST
  • Endpoint: /api/v2/RotateImageByExifData

Supported EXIF-Based Image Rotation Features

The API provides comprehensive support for various EXIF-based image rotation and processing capabilities:

EXIF Data Analysis

  • Automatic Detection: Automatically detect EXIF orientation data from image metadata
  • Intelligent Analysis: Smart analysis of EXIF orientation tags for accurate rotation decisions
  • Format Support: Support for various image formats with EXIF data support
  • Professional Results: High-quality EXIF analysis with accurate orientation detection
  • Advanced Processing: Support for complex EXIF data structures and orientation requirements

Automatic Rotation

  • Smart Rotation: Intelligent rotation algorithms that apply correct orientation automatically
  • Quality Preservation: Maintain image quality during automatic rotation operations
  • Content Protection: Preserve image content and prevent data loss during rotation
  • Professional Layout: High-quality image rotation with accurate orientation correction
  • Advanced Processing: Support for various rotation angles and orientation scenarios

Image Processing

  • Quality Enhancement: Automatic image preprocessing for optimal rotation results
  • Format Support: Support for various image formats and EXIF data structures
  • Professional Enhancement: High-quality image processing with accurate rotation
  • Flexible Options: Customizable processing parameters for specific requirements

REST API Parameters

Complete list of parameters for the Rotate Image By EXIF Data REST API. Parameters are organized by category for better understanding and implementation.

Important: Parameters marked with an asterisk (*) are required and must be provided for the API to function correctly.

Required Parameters

ParameterTypeDescriptionExample
docName*StringThe source image filename with proper file extension for EXIF-based rotation operations. This parameter identifies the input image for EXIF analysis, orientation correction, and automatic rotation workflows. Required for image identification and processing pipeline management in EXIF-based rotation operations.image.jpg
docContent*StringThe complete content of the source image encoded in Base64 format for EXIF-based rotation processing. This parameter contains the entire image data required for EXIF analysis, orientation correction, and automatic rotation workflows. Essential for secure image handling and API-based EXIF rotation operations.JVBERi...

Output

The PDF4me Rotate Image By EXIF Data REST API returns a response that can be viewed in multiple formats. Choose the view that best fits your needs:

JSON Response Format

The raw JSON response from the API:

{
"File Content": "Output file content from the PDF4me Connect"
}

Request Example

Content-Type: application/json
Authorization: YOUR_API_KEY

Note: Get your API key from the PDF4me Dashboard

Payload

{
"docName": "image.jpg",
"docContent": "Please put image base64 content"
}

Code Samples

The PDF4me Rotate Image By EXIF Data REST API provides code samples in multiple programming languages. Choose the language that best fits your development environment:

C# (CSharp) Sample

Complete C# implementation for EXIF-based image rotation:

EXIF-Based Image Rotation Features

EXIF Data Analysis

  • Automatic Detection: Automatically detect EXIF orientation data from image metadata
  • Intelligent Analysis: Smart analysis of EXIF orientation tags for accurate rotation decisions
  • Format Support: Support for various image formats with EXIF data support
  • Professional Results: High-quality EXIF analysis with accurate orientation detection
  • Advanced Processing: Support for complex EXIF data structures and orientation requirements

Automatic Rotation

  • Smart Rotation: Intelligent rotation algorithms that apply correct orientation automatically
  • Quality Preservation: Maintain image quality during automatic rotation operations
  • Content Protection: Preserve image content and prevent data loss during rotation
  • Professional Layout: High-quality image rotation with accurate orientation correction
  • Advanced Processing: Support for various rotation angles and orientation scenarios

Image Processing

  • Quality Enhancement: Automatic image preprocessing for optimal rotation results
  • Format Support: Support for various image formats and EXIF data structures
  • Professional Enhancement: High-quality image processing with accurate rotation
  • Flexible Options: Customizable processing parameters for specific requirements

Industry Use Cases & Applications

Use Cases

  • Photo Processing: Automatically correct orientation of photos from digital cameras and mobile devices
  • Content Management: Process images with correct orientation for content management systems
  • E-commerce: Ensure product images display correctly with proper orientation
  • Social Media: Automatically correct image orientation for social media platforms
  • Web Development: Process images with correct orientation for web applications
  • Print Production: Ensure images have correct orientation for print materials
  • Mobile Applications: Process images with correct orientation for mobile apps
  • Business Process Automation: Automate image orientation correction workflows for enterprise operations

Get Help